Method 1: The Direct Calculation Method
The most straightforward way to calculate 34 out of 40 as a percentage is to use the following formula:
(Part / Whole) x 100% = Percentage
In this case:
- Part: 34 (the number we're considering as a portion of the whole)
- Whole: 40 (the total number)
Substituting these values into the formula, we get:
(34 / 40) x 100% = 0.85 x 100% = 85%
Because of this, 34 out of 40 is 85%.
Method 2: Simplifying the Fraction First
An alternative approach involves simplifying the fraction 34/40 before converting it to a percentage. Both 34 and 40 are divisible by 2, so we can simplify the fraction:
34/40 = 17/20
Now, to convert 17/20 to a percentage, we use the same formula:
(17 / 20) x 100% = 0.85 x 100% = 85%
This method demonstrates that simplifying the fraction beforehand doesn't alter the final percentage result. It often makes the calculation easier, especially with larger numbers That's the part that actually makes a difference..
Method 3: Using Proportions
Another way to approach this problem is by using proportions. We can set up a proportion to find the equivalent percentage:
34/40 = x/100
To solve for 'x' (the percentage), we cross-multiply:
40x = 3400
x = 3400 / 40
x = 85
That's why, x = 85%, confirming our previous results. This method is particularly useful for understanding the underlying relationship between fractions and percentages No workaround needed..

Addressing Common Misconceptions about Percentages
Several common misconceptions surround percentage calculations. Let's clarify some of them:
-
Adding Percentages Directly: It's incorrect to simply add percentages without considering the base value. To give you an idea, a 10% increase followed by a 10% decrease does not result in the original value. The second 10% decrease is calculated from the new, increased value.
-
Confusing Percentage Change with Percentage Points: A change of 10 percentage points is different from a 10% change. If something increases from 20% to 30%, that's a 10 percentage point increase, but a 50% increase relative to the original value (10/20 = 0.5 = 50%).
-
Incorrect Interpretation of Percentage Increase/Decrease: Always clearly define the base value when discussing percentage increases or decreases to avoid ambiguity. A 10% increase on $100 is different from a 10% increase on $1000.
Advanced Percentage Calculations: Beyond the Basics
While calculating 34/40 as a percentage is a relatively straightforward process, understanding percentages extends beyond simple calculations. More complex scenarios might involve:
-
Calculating Percentage Increase or Decrease: Determining the percentage change between two values requires subtracting the initial value from the final value, dividing by the initial value, and multiplying by 100%.
-
Finding the Original Value: If you know the percentage and the resulting value, you can use algebraic equations to find the original value.
-
Compounding Percentages: When dealing with multiple percentage changes, compounding effects must be considered. Each subsequent percentage change is calculated based on the previous result Worth keeping that in mind. Still holds up..
Frequently Asked Questions (FAQ)
Q: How do I calculate a percentage increase?
A: To calculate a percentage increase, subtract the original value from the new value, divide the result by the original value, and multiply by 100% That's the part that actually makes a difference..
Q: How do I convert a decimal to a percentage?
A: To convert a decimal to a percentage, multiply the decimal by 100% And it works..
Q: How do I convert a fraction to a percentage?
A: To convert a fraction to a percentage, divide the numerator by the denominator and then multiply the result by 100% Which is the point..
Q: What if I have a negative number in my calculation?
A: Negative numbers in percentage calculations usually indicate a decrease. The magnitude of the negative number still follows the same calculation principles.
